Summerland Point - Gwandalan · Statistical Area 2 (SA2)
Who lives here — how many people, how old they are, and how communities identify.
A typical resident in Summerland Point - Gwandalan is 45 years old, which is noticeably older than the national figure of 38. This is an aging area where the population has grown by 20% since 2011 to reach 6,492 people. The community is defined by a high proportion of seniors and a significant Indigenous population.

How the population splits across age groups.
Seniors aged 65 and over make up 22.9% of the population, which is well above the national figure of 17.2%. Meanwhile, children under 15 have fallen to 17.2%, a figure slightly below the state and national averages.

First Nations identity and marital status.
About 6.1% of residents identify as Aboriginal or Torres Strait Islander, which is much higher than most areas. De facto relationships are also more common here than in other areas, making up 13.4% of the population.
